San Francisco: The Epicenter of Big Tech and AI
The San Francisco Bay Area is synonymous with technology giants such as Google, Facebook, and Apple, positioning it as the leading hub for innovation and high-paying jobs. Companies in this region not only offer competitive salaries but also boast unique benefits that attract talent from around the world.
As of 2019, the average monthly salary in San Francisco reached approximately $6,526, translating into an annual income exceeding $78,000. This figure represents a substantial increase of 31% over the previous year and an impressive 88% since 2014, highlighting the city's robust economic growth.
For comparison, residents in New York earn an average of only $4,612 monthly, which is a striking 29% less than their San Francisco counterparts. However, when comparing New York City to San Francisco, it's essential to consider that NYC has a significantly larger population, thus skewing some of the salary comparisons.

Interestingly, Chicago ranks fifth despite its reputation for harsh winters and high crime rates. The city offers excellent value in terms of housing, with median prices around $226,400, significantly lower than San Francisco's staggering average of approximately $1.7 million.

The Harsh Reality of Living in Hong Kong
For many, living in Hong Kong is a precarious balancing act. With average monthly earnings below $2,500 and rental costs for a two-bedroom apartment reaching $3,685, residents experience a financial squeeze. The rent is approximately 47.4% higher than the average salary, making it nearly impossible for many to thrive without significant financial help.
This scenario often forces residents to make difficult choices, such as living in cramped quarters or relying on family support. The ongoing social unrest and economic challenges further exacerbate this situation, underscoring the importance of both income and living costs in determining a city’s desirability.
